Ingredients

Adjust Servings:
2 large firm peaches, not too ripe
2 tablespoons butter
4 tablespoons sugar
2 tablespoons brown sugar

    Steps

    1
    Done

    Peel and Halve Peaches.

    2
    Done

    Melt Butter in Skillet.

    3
    Done

    Place Cut Side Down in Skillet.

    4
    Done

    When Edges Are Browned, Turn Over.

    5
    Done

    Sprinkle With Half the Sugars and Allow Other Side to Brown.

    6
    Done

    Turn Once More and Sprinkle With Remaining Sugars.

    7
    Done

    Cook Until Sugars Caramelize Slightly, Turning Peaches to Coat.

    8
    Done

    Serve as Is or Top With Whipped Cream and Chopped Pecans.
